Title
An Ordinance creating Section 3-29 of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to define commercial quadricycles; an Ordinance creating Section 3-29(2)(1)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les that a permit is required to operate a commercial quadricycle;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(a) to require a written application for a permit;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(b) to require general liability insurance to operate a commercial quadricycle;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(c) to require that every commercial quadricycle have a safety inspection;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(d)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to require submission of a proposed travel route;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(e)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to require an Annual Permit Fee of $250; creating Section 3-29(2)(1)(f)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to allow for submission of any other documents as the Div. of Alcoholic Beverage Control may require; creating Section 3-29(2)(2)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to provide for denial, suspension or revocation of the permit; creating Section 3-29(2)(2)(a) to provide for denial, suspension or revocation of a permit if the applicant fails to comply with one or more provisions of the chapter; creating Section 3-29(2)(2)(b) to provide for denial, suspension or revocation of a permit for fraud or misrepresentation in securing the permit; creating Section 3-29(2)(2)(c)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to provide for denial, suspension or revocation of a permit for fraud, or misrepresentation on the application; creating Section 3-29(2)(2)(d)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ial quadricycles to provide for denial, suspension or revocation if the permit is altered, defaced or counterfeited; creating Section 3-29(2)(2)(e) of the Code of Ordinances related to commercial...
